I shipped my 928 Spyder twice with Reliable Carriers with positive results both times. Once from KY to WI, then from WI to SC. Because of the fairly remote destination point in WI, it made a stopover at their Detroit hub both times, but they told me going in that it wouldn't be point to point. Nice, professional drivers, car arrived in good condition both times, etc. I'd use them again and also might look at Angel's which I think is also a Rennlist sponsor that has positivr reviews. So, I finally did recently have a 928 moved by VIP Transport Inc. (www.viptransportinc.com).
They have a nice facility in Charlotte where you can drop a car off, and it is taken care of. It is a kind of facility for classic cars. So, it's comfortable to work them, if you have a car in above average shape.
But, they did have truck troubles in the Chicago area. That caused about a week delay. Overall, though I was happy, because the handling of the car seemed conscientious.
They aren't brokers, and they seem to own their own trucks. BUT, beaware because I think there is another company with a similar name that is a broker. (For this reason, I put the weblink in to the company I finally used.)
They will be the first company I contact, when I move a 928 again.
